学习编程,你想要达成什么目标?-理解编程语言基础-Box编程的优势是什么

学习编程,你想要达成什么目标?

学习编程,我们通常想要达到以下几个重要目标:提高逻辑思维能力、理解编程语言基础、开发项目和团队协作。这些技能对于解决问题和开发实用软件非常重要。

一、提高逻辑思维能力

逻辑思维是编程的核心,它不仅仅是学习语言语法,更重要的是培养解决问题的思维方式。通过大量的问题解决练习,我们可以增强逻辑推理能力,这对于高效识别问题、规划解决方案,以及提高代码的效率和质量至关重要。

二、理解编程语言基础

编程语言是和计算机沟通的桥梁,学会至少一种编程语言的基本语法、结构和概念是基础中的基础。掌握数据类型、变量、控制结构、函数和对象等基本构造,为学习更复杂的编程概念打下坚实基础。

三、开发项目

项目开发是实现理论知识与实践应用相结合的关键。通过实际创建软件应用或参与开发项目,我们可以加深对编程概念的理解,并获得宝贵的实战经验。项目开发通常涉及需求收集、系统设计、编码、测试和维护等多个环节。

四、团队协作

编程往往不是一个人的事,尤其是在大型项目中。学习如何在团队中有效沟通、协作和解决冲突是职业成长的关键。熟悉版本控制工具,如Git,也是团队编程中不可或缺的技能。

通过学习上述技能,我们可以构建一个坚实的编程基础,并为未来的技术挑战做好准备。不断地实践和学习新技术是编程之旅中永恒的主题。

相关问答FAQs

1. Box编程是什么?

Box编程是一种声明式编程范式,用于创建和组织反应式的用户界面。它基于组件的概念,每个组件被封装在一个box中,这些box可以互相嵌套形成一个组件树。Box编程可以简化界面逻辑的开发和维护,提供更高效、可维护的代码。

2. Box编程的优势是什么?

优势 描述
简化UI开发 高级抽象使得UI开发变得简单直观。
组件化 鼓励使用组件化的开发模式,提高开发效率。
响应式 界面能够自动对数据的变化做出响应,提升用户体验。
可维护性 组件化和声明式特性使得代码维护更加容易。

3. 如何学习Box编程?

  1. 了解框架:选择一种流行的Box编程框架,如React、Vue或Angular等,并学习其基本概念和特性。
  2. 学习语法:掌握框架所采用的Box编程语法。
  3. 实践项目:通过实际项目的练习来巩固学到的知识。
  4. 参考资料:阅读相关的书籍、博客文章和教程,参加相关的培训课程和在线学习资源。
  5. 实践和反馈:在实践过程中遇到问题是正常的,利用社区和论坛寻求帮助和反馈。